Founded in 1997 and headquartered in Oslo, Norway, Photocure ASA has carved a niche for itself by focusing on the research, development, production, distribution, marketing, and sale of specialized pharmaceutical products and related technical medical equipment. The company’s strategic operations span the Nordic countries and the United States, underscoring its commitment to addressing critical health care needs across diverse markets.

A cornerstone of Photocure ASA’s product portfolio is Hexvix/Cysview, a diagnostic tool designed for the detection and management of bladder cancer. This product exemplifies the company’s dedication to leveraging cutting-edge technology to improve patient outcomes in oncology. Additionally, Photocure ASA is actively developing Visonac, aimed at treating moderate to severe acne, and Cevira, targeting human papilloma virus infection and precancerous lesions of the cervix. These developments highlight the company’s strategic focus on addressing unmet medical needs and expanding its therapeutic offerings.

Photocure ASA’s business model is characterized by its collaboration with license partners, pharmaceutical wholesalers, and hospitals, facilitating the widespread distribution and accessibility of its products.
